Journey into Kerala and journey into a book

The journey from Manglore to mahe was energizing and fantastic. Around 7.30 am, we left Mangalore by train to Mahe. The sun had risen and its rich golden light had spread everywhere, on the foliage, on the fields and on the river.   Touched with the sun rays, the water was glistening like gold, making the scene splendid. The train was speeding up amidst the thick greenery filled with coconut, areca and other trees. The lush green paddy fields soothed my eyes and soul. Train journey that too amidst greenery makes me very romantic. I was ruminating on why the palette of kerala artists is so rich and vivid.   The bright cobalt blue sky was complementary to the sunlight covered lush green paddy fields.   Here and there, I could see white Kerala houses. Most of the houses are painted in white. Probably, they prefer white colour, which is   easily noticed amidst the green nature. The language Of Dress

LANGUAGE OF DRESS                                In 60s and 70s, tailors were very much in demand.   Ready-to-wear clothing was not available in small towns, and in fact, nobody liked to wear readymade dress in those days. To discover a good tailor and get dresses stitched properly by them was an uphill task.   With lot of hopes and dreams, one used to give the fabric material along with a page torn from the magazine, which carried the photograph or sketch of a latest fashionable skirt or top, in it.   Seeing the photograph, the tailor would nod and say he would stitch it the same way. He used to enter the details of measurements in a long note book, which had turned yellow with the passage of time and the pages at the corners had curled by constant usage.
